Amador
From Latin amator, meaning "lover" or "one who loves"; an agent noun derived from amare "to love".
Meaning and origin
Amador is a Spanish masculine name formed from the Latin amator, building on the same root as Amado but with the active agent meaning of "lover" or "one who loves".
